Dhaka, Feb. 5 -- Canadian Prime Minister's special envoy to Myanmar Bob Rae on Tuesday suggested a transitional plan for Rohingyas living in Bangladesh before they are sent to their place of origin in Rakhine State in a sustainable manner.

"Not short or long-term, we need to make a transitional plan for the Rohingyas," he said emphasising on education and income-generating activities for the Rohingyas keeping the ongoing efforts for repatriation unhindered.

Bob Rae said those responsible for the atrocities against the Rohingya must face accountability and noted that the process has progressed which will have to continue.
